BJP ahead of Congress in run-up to general elections

The results of the Gujarat and Himachal Pradesh assembly elections, along with that of Municipal Corporation of Delhi has made all three parties, namely, the BJP, the Congress and the AAP, happy. The massive victory of the BJP in Gujarat shows that Prime Minister Narendra Modi and the BJP still have complete grip over the state. Gujarat is considered to be the original laboratory of Hindutva politics. The communal politics of the BJP has paid dividends and it seems like they will continue to rule Gujarat for many more years with this trend.

The Himachal Pradesh result is bit of a surprise. Many thought it would be a close battle and that the BJP might spring a surprise. The saffron party pumped in huge money and the Congress could not match them. The victory is a massive boost to party leader Priyanka Gandhi Vadra, who had campaigned extensively during the election. However, the Gujarat and MCD results should worry the Congress. In Gujarat, the AAP has managed to hurt the Congress and this can be repeated in others parts of India. The party needs to look into it. In Delhi too, the Congress is struggling to make a presence. With just one-and-a-half year remaining for the general election, the BJP looks way ahead of the Congress.
